                First impression of MySensors running on nRF24LE1. Reporting temperature / humidity from DHT22, VCC voltage and millis() timer.

                This SoC has many interesting features (SPI, 2-Wire, Serial, GPIO, ADC, RNG, AES accelerator, etc. ) and sub uA sleeping modes - without the need to solder a RF module. However, flash size limited to 16kB - still more than enough for many (peripheral) sensors... :)

                20150810_nRF24LE1_DHT22.jpg

                Readings in MYSController:

                20150810_nRF24LE1.png

                Compiling with SDCC and nRF24LE1 SDK.
                Source (Proof of concept/POC, non-optimized) here.

                                      @jobarjo thanks for taking a look. The Wiring library isn't much more than a bunch of macros for the SDK. I chose to do it that way because SDCC will keep unused code in the output it generates. So yes, there is most everything you would expect if you are coming from arduino. digitalRead etc are all there.

                                      There is also a very alpha version of the RF24 library. It is in C of course, so a small amount of porting is needed.

                                      Let me know if you run into any problems. I am busy with another project at the moment with the nrf51822 SoC which is actually similarly priced and much more capable, although much more cumbersome to work with at the moment.
